ROAST CARROTS
In this Roast Carrots recipe you'll learn how to parboil carrots as well as how long to roast carrots for. The end results? Super sweet, caramelised carrots!

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 200°C/180°C fan/gas 6.
- Either scrub the carrots thoroughly or peel them.
- Top and tail the vegetables, then halve or quarter them lengthways.
- Bring a large pan of salted water to the boil.
- Add the carrots and boil for 5 minutes.
- Drain the vegetables in a colander.
- Toss the carrots in a large roasting tin with the oil and season to taste.
- Roast the carrots for 30-40 mins.
- Serve immediately as a side dish.

MY TOP 6 TIPS FOR PERFECT ROAST VEGETABLES – BEC'S TABLE
From becs-table.com.au
Estimated Reading Time 7 minsPublished 2018-07-07
- First, preheat your oven. I know you know that but do you know why it’s important? The actual temp can be anywhere from 180°c to 200°c, and it will work fine.
- Don’t overcrowd your pan. If you have all your vegetables crammed into the same pan, they’ll steam instead of roast. Just like if you overcrowd your fry pan when browning off meat.
- Make sure you’ve cut your vegetables into the correct sizes. When I say that, I mean if you’re doing a whole tray of potatoes you need to make sure they’re all about the same size.
- If your oven doesn’t heat evenly. turn your tray around halfway through, just like you would a cake or tray of cookies. You can also give the vegetables a shake-up or turn them over.
- You can add different types of vegetables at varying times throughout the roasting period. For instance, carrots and beetroots are pretty hard root vegetables.
- I roast vegetable that some may not have thought about like brussel sprouts or broccoli. These go in later in the roasting period. I trim them, cut them to size and parcook them in boiling water.
